Title |
Reciprocal Symmetric Algebra and Correspondence between Relativistic and Quantum Mechanical Concepts | |||||
Co-authors | ||||||||
Abstract |
We have shown that Planck's hypothesis (which sets a lower limit) is reciprocally related to Einstein's postulate (which sets an upper limit). We have postulated that numbers and their reciprocals are equally valid representations of the same physical quantity. We have developed generalized algebraic operations (addition and multiplication) which include both numbers and their reciprocals. Addition in number representation gives the Einstein's law of addition of velocities; in reciprocal representation, it gives the law of addition of tachyons. |

Title |
Reciprocal Correspondence between Relativistic and Quantum Mechanical Concepts and Continuous and Descrete Description of the Same Motion | |||||
Co-authors | ||||||||
Abstract |
We have postulated reciprocal symmetric sum of velocities, which remains invariant if velocities are replaced by their reciprocals. Einstein's law of addition of velocities is reciprocal symmetric. Velocities and their reciprocals (like de Broglie wave velocity)relate relativistic quantities to their corresponding quantum mechanical quantities. Direct velocities give distance with continuous time while reciprocal velocities give distances for discrete time. |
